Dental amalgam has a huge amount of mercury. If you have a high amount of mercury in your body, you can pass it to your infant through the placenta or when nursing.


Mercury also can create damage to the mind, kidneys and other body organs. You need to not obtain dental amalgam dental fillings if you are pregnant, intending to get expectant or nursing, according to the united state Food and Drug Administration (FDA). If you need to have a cavity filled, ask your dentist for a mercury-free composite resin dental filling.

If without treatment, it can lead to extra major gum condition. Signs and signs and symptoms include: Soreness and swelling Inflammation in the periodontals Blood loss of the gums, also when you comb your teeth gently Shiny periodontals High degrees of the hormonal agents progesterone and estrogen during pregnancy can momentarily loosen up the tissues and bones that maintain your teeth in area.


If gingivitis is unattended, it can bring about periodontal illness. This creates severe infection in the gums and issues with the bones that support the teeth. Your teeth might get loose, and they may have to be removed (drawn). Periodontitis can lead to bacteremia (microorganisms in the blood stream). This is a serious condition that requires prompt treatment.

Regular teeth cleansings help maintain your teeth and gum tissues healthy. Dental X-rays can show issues with your teeth, periodontals and the bones around your mouth.


Dental X-rays are secure throughout pregnancy. They use very little amounts of radiation, and your dental practitioner covers you with a special apron and collar to shield you and your baby.
